The Indian National Congress clarified that it would not stake claim to the post of Leader of Opposition in the Lower House of Parliament. Congress leader Randeep Surjewala said that since the party is short of the required number by 2 seats, it won't seek the LoP position, but onus lies on the government to decide if it wants to designate a party as the principal opposition. Congress secured 52 seats in the recently concluded Lok Sabha elections 2019.
